The B5 Audi A4 1.8T has gained a reputation among enthusiasts for its tuning potential and performance capabilities. One of the most critical decisions for owners looking to increase power is choosing the right turbocharger. In this article, we will compare the K03 and K04 turbochargers, focusing on their power output and reliability.
Overview of the B5 A4 1.8T Turbochargers
The B5 A4 1.8T is equipped with two primary turbocharger options: the K03 and the K04. Each turbocharger offers different performance characteristics and has its own set of advantages and disadvantages.
K03 Turbocharger
The K03 turbocharger is the stock option for the B5 A4 1.8T. It is designed for a balance of performance and reliability, making it a suitable choice for daily drivers.
Power Output
The K03 typically produces around 150 to 180 horsepower, depending on the vehicle’s tuning and supporting modifications. This power level is adequate for most drivers who seek a reliable and efficient vehicle.
Reliability
One of the significant advantages of the K03 is its reliability. Many owners report that the K03 can last well beyond 100,000 miles with proper maintenance. It is less prone to failure compared to larger turbochargers, making it a dependable choice for everyday use.
K04 Turbocharger
The K04 turbocharger is a popular upgrade for those looking to boost performance significantly. It is often regarded as a more powerful option compared to the K03.
Power Output
The K04 can produce between 200 to 250 horsepower, depending on supporting modifications and tuning. This increase in power makes it an attractive option for enthusiasts seeking a more aggressive driving experience.
Reliability
While the K04 offers more power, it can be less reliable than the K03 if not properly maintained. The increased boost pressure and heat can lead to turbocharger failure if the vehicle is not tuned correctly or if supporting modifications are inadequate.
Comparative Analysis
When comparing the K03 and K04 turbochargers, several factors should be considered to make an informed decision.
- Power Needs: Determine how much power you need from your vehicle. The K03 is suitable for daily driving, while the K04 is better for performance enthusiasts.
- Reliability: If reliability is your primary concern, the K03 may be the better choice. However, if you are willing to invest in supporting modifications, the K04 can be reliable as well.
- Cost: The K04 is typically more expensive than the K03. Consider your budget when making a decision.
- Modification Support: Ensure that you have the necessary supporting modifications if you choose the K04 to avoid reliability issues.
